We kicked off Orientation Week at ELTE Faculty of Humanities with a Welcome Ceremony, celebrating the arrival of nearly 700 international students. The new cohort includes participants in Erasmus exchange programmes and recipients of the Stipendium Hungaricum scholarship, as well as students enrolled in Foundation, BA, MA programmes and PhD studies.
The event began with an inaugural address by Dr. Orsolya Réthelyi, Vice-Dean for International Affairs followed by informative presentations from the Department of International Affairs, student representatives, and faculty lecturers.

Throughout the week, students will take part in a diverse range of activities, including campus tours, orientation sessions, and social events designed to help them settle in and connect with their peers. The full schedule of events is available online.
The Faculty’s international coordinators are excited to welcome our new ELTE citizens and support their integration into university life through shared experiences and community-building initiatives.
ELTE’s Faculty of Humanities continues to lead the field of humanities in Hungary, both in terms of academic excellence and international appeal. Its interdisciplinary approach, global partnerships, and research-driven teaching make it a hub for students passionate about culture, language, and society. The record number of international students joining in the 2025 autumn semester confirms the Faculty’s growing global reputation.
